PROLEEK PRINCE has been steadily progressive since being switched to handicaps and he's fancied to follow up his breakthrough success at Punchestown last month at the chief expense of Copie Conforme, who is 2-2 at this course but may have to settle for silver this time. The Bog Bank, who boasts 4 C&D wins and was successful here again just over 5 weeks ago, completes the shortlist.
